Welcome to WarCry! War Cry For Our Children — the podcast where street truth meets spiritual fire, and community voices rise in unison for the next generation. Today's episode features Mr. Edwin Santana.

Edwin Santana is a Puerto Rican Freedom Fighter, a Spoken Word artist, a formerly incarcerated individual, and an advocate for Criminal Justice. Edwin has worked as a Case Manager for organizations such as Harlem United and the Institute of Justice and Opportunity (formerly known as PRI). He spent many years as a Campaign Leader for the #CLOSERikers campaign at JustLeadershipUSA and is currently a member of the New York Campaign for Alternatives to Isolated Confinement, The Riker’s Island Public Memory Project, and The Fortune Society. In April 2021, Edwin founded Tuff Art Media, a production company based in New York City.
